Bachelor of Science (Honours) in Forensic Medicine

University of Zimbabwe · Harare

About this programme

Applies medical knowledge to legal investigations, covering forensic pathology, toxicology and evidence-based practice. Graduates support the Zimbabwean justice system through expert medical testimony and investigation.

Programme facts

Qualificationbachelors
InstitutionUniversity of Zimbabwe
Faculty / schoolFaculty of Medicine and Health Science
Duration4 years
LocationHarare
Minimum points11
AccreditationZIMCHE-accredited
Funding / sponsorshipZIMDEF (Zimbabwe Manpower Development Fund): government scholarships and loans for priority-field students, plus Presidential and National Scholarships (OPC) for bilateral study abroad — contact [email protected] or apply in person at provincial offices for Presidential Scholarships.

Careers this programme leads to

Forensic Medicine Practitioner Forensic Pathologist Assistant Toxicology Laboratory Analyst Medico-Legal Expert Police Medical Officer Court Expert Witness Forensic Toxicologist Criminal Investigation Specialist Mortuary Technician Forensic Researcher
